# Break-Glass: Probe Gateway

Scope: health checks behind the Falkner load balancer for Quillet plugin endpoints.

If probes report all-green while traffic fails, the checker is wedged. Break-glass grants direct access to the probe controller, bypassing the Quillet auth mesh. Use only when paging Orvis Systems ops gets no response within 15 minutes. Log every action. The break-glass recovery passphrase is as follows.

recovery phrase for bawef-haduf: wenax-druox-julmir

Ticket: Template render times regressed after the Larkspur 3.2 merge. Pages with nested partials now take roughly twice as long to compile. We suspect the new escaping layer re-parses templates on every request instead of using the cache. Fix is ready in a branch and benchmarked. Before merging, this ticket needs sign-off from the engineer named below.

account owner for bawip-tahag: Raleth Quenok

Subject: DR drill Thursday — Dedupewren failover

Hey, quick heads-up before Thursday's disaster-recovery drill. We'll be failing Dedupewren (the alert deduplicator) over to the Tarnbeck standby cluster, so expect a few duplicate pages to sneak through while the fingerprint cache rebuilds. Don't ack anything from the synthetic source — those are mine. If the standby refuses to unseal its state store, you'll need to unlock it manually from the console. The passphrase for that is right here.

recovery phrase for fajeg-hagug: holox-fenmir

We maintain three environments: dev, staging, and prod. Historically, dev used float arithmetic while prod used fixed-point decimals, which hid rounding errors until release — sub-cent discrepancies accumulated across batch conversions and broke ledger reconciliation. All environments now use identical decimal settings, and any divergence is treated as an incident. New team members should verify their local setup matches before running conversions. The canonical environment configuration is as follows.

settings of fafog-haduf:
ZORIX_PIN=4648
ZORIX_METRICS_HOST=metrics.zorix.paliqsys.corp
ZORIX_LOG_LEVEL=info
ZORIX_TENANT=druix